Fred VanVleet (illness) ruled out for Raptors on Monday
Toronto Raptors guard Fred VanVleet will not play Monday in the team's game against the Detroit Pistons.
VanVleet is still dealing with his non-COVID illness, and as a result, he will miss another contest. Otto Porter should see another start if the Raptors want to play big, and Malachi Flynn should also see a boost in workload.
In 10 games this season, VanVleet is averaging 18.4 points, 3.7 rebounds, 6.8 assists and 40.6 FanDuel points.
